According to a statement by the Department of Electrical and Mechanical Services Department, 37 ambulances are being made and delivered to Cyprus by a French company. The total cost of the ambulances comes to 3,740,156 euros.  Cyprus have already received 13 ambulances, another 15 ambulances will be delivered in September this year and nine in early 2012.

 The  37 ambulances, nine are  four-wheel drive and 28 with two-wheel drive. Thirty-two ambulances, yellow, are intended to cover the needs of the Ministry of Health and five Green colour, covering the needs of the Ministry of Defence.
